Case Summary: SLP(C) No. 1778/2002 On 25/02/2002, the Supreme Court (Justices B.N. Kirpal and Arijit Pasayat) heard Haryana Financial Corporation's Special Leave Petition challenging a High Court of Punjab & Haryana judgment dated 26/07/2001. The Court condoned the delay in filing the petition but dismissed it, finding no grounds to interfere under Article 136 of the Constitution, while leaving the question of law open.
